I have a note 3 and I was experiencing a lot of drop/disconnects.
I found to fix my issue I decline to transfer contacts and for some reason I haven't had a problem since (~3 weeks). If anyone wants to try it out, delete the phone from the car, and delete the car from the phone. Then try to pair it back up and when the phone asks you to accept connetion from the car say yes the first time. Then it will say it wants access to contacts and click cancel. |

Create an account to login, then download the Subaru Toolbox PC-Tool software for your PC. Once the software is installed, plug in the SD Card from the sat nav into the PC, the software will recognizes the card (I think it is encrypted) and there will appear a free update for it (not maps but generalized update). You can also buy the map update separately (weird I just got the $150 update and it's fine, looks like the $184 updates are US headunit specific?). |
